No files found.
+4 −4
Cargo.lock
Cargo.lock
+2 −2
wrapper.rs
components/layout/wrapper.rs
+7 −6
callback.rs
components/script/dom/bindings/callback.rs
+395 −222
CodegenRust.py
components/script/dom/bindings/codegen/CodegenRust.py
+28 −31
conversions.rs
components/script/dom/bindings/conversions.rs
+11 −11
error.rs
components/script/dom/bindings/error.rs
+169 −21
js.rs
components/script/dom/bindings/js.rs
+39 −34
proxyhandler.rs
components/script/dom/bindings/proxyhandler.rs
+76 −18
trace.rs
components/script/dom/bindings/trace.rs
+163 −116
utils.rs
components/script/dom/bindings/utils.rs
+84 −11
browsercontext.rs
components/script/dom/browsercontext.rs
+12 −8
dedicatedworkerglobalscope.rs
components/script/dom/dedicatedworkerglobalscope.rs
+14 −15
document.rs
components/script/dom/document.rs
+17 −14
element.rs
components/script/dom/element.rs
+9 −8
event.rs
components/script/dom/event.rs
+15 −19
eventdispatcher.rs
components/script/dom/eventdispatcher.rs
+22 −16
eventtarget.rs
components/script/dom/eventtarget.rs
+1 −1
htmlimageelement.rs
components/script/dom/htmlimageelement.rs
+5 −4
mouseevent.rs
components/script/dom/mouseevent.rs
+46 −41
node.rs
components/script/dom/node.rs
+2 −2
treewalker.rs
components/script/dom/treewalker.rs
+5 −4
uievent.rs
components/script/dom/uievent.rs
+23 −19
window.rs
components/script/dom/window.rs
+14 −11
worker.rs
components/script/dom/worker.rs
+10 −10
xmlhttprequest.rs
components/script/dom/xmlhttprequest.rs
+2 −0
hubbub_html_parser.rs
components/script/html/hubbub_html_parser.rs
+13 −0
lib.rs
components/script/lib.rs
+4 −3
page.rs
components/script/page.rs
+33 −14
script_task.rs
components/script/script_task.rs
+1 −1
lib.rs
components/util/lib.rs
+5 −5
Cargo.lock
ports/cef/Cargo.lock
+5 −1
lib.rs
src/lib.rs
+1 −0
test_global.html
tests/content/test_global.html
+4 −0
test_interfaces.html
tests/content/test_interfaces.html